More people in Northern Ireland are Catholics than Protestants for the first time in its 101-year history. Kieran was joined by Barry Whyte, Newstalk’s Chief Reporter to discuss the census figures.

Gregory Campbell, DUP MP also joined Kieran on The Hard Shoulder...
